Chicken Wild Rice Soup
This Chicken Wild Rice Soup is creamy, savory, and loaded with tender chicken and nutritious vegetables. It’s a fantastic way to warm up during chilly evenings or enjoy a soothing meal anytime!
Ingredients
- 1 cup cooked wild rice
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 onion, diced
- 2 carrots, diced
- 2 celery stalks, diced
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on dried thyme
- 1 teaspoon dried rosemary
- 6 cups chicken broth
- 2 cups cooked chicken, shredded or diced
- 1 cup heavy cream
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
Instructions
- In a large pot,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the diced onions, carrots, and celery. Sauté for about 5-7 minutes, or until the vegetables are softened and the onions are translucent.
- Add the minced garlic, thyme, and rosemary. Cook for an additional minute, stirring frequently to avoid burning the garlic.
- Pour in the chicken broth and bring the mixture to a boil. Once boiling, reduce the heat to a simmer.
- Add the cooked wild rice and shredded chicken into the pot. Let it simmer for about 10 minutes, allowing all the flavors to meld together.
- Stir in the heavy cream and let the soup heat through.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Serve hot, garnished with fresh parsley for a beautiful finish!
